In a typical workflow, a primary or emergency physician will first order a particular image study. Typically, the central hub for x-ray images in these facilities is the DICOM protocol PACs system. Unfortunately, Imaging Centers, Health Clinics and Hospitals use very different information systems and workflow, whether it be how procedures are ordered, or how the image is scanned, reviewed and diagnosis performed. Therefore, most panoramic x-rays are designed and optimized to work in this environment. The main driver behind this challenge is that most of the panoramic x-ray solution providers are more familiar with traditional dental offices and dental office workflows. One of the main challenges that these facilities face is integrating these pieces of equipment with their facility PACs. Cone beam x-rays help reduce the risk of complications, which in turn leads to more predictable and precise outcomes.1. For complex implant cases, this type of x-ray is the ultimate technology that allows your doctor not only to take a look at your specific anatomic conditions, but also to plan in advance a highly precise surgical solution. Best of all, the original scan data can be duplicated anytime to provide different specialists with images if needed later. This new technology provides more complete visual information to study your dental case from every angle.
